What does an SBA loan mean?

An SBA loan is a government-backed loan designed to help small businesses obtain funding. The Small Business Administration guarantees a portion of the loan, reducing risk for lenders and making it easier for businesses to qualify for capital. This allows for more accessible financing for growth and operations.

What is an SBA loan?

An SBA loan is a type of financing provided by private lenders but partially guaranteed by the U.S. Small Business Administration. This guarantee encourages lenders to offer favorable terms, such as longer repayment periods and lower down payments, to eligible small businesses across states like Kansas.

Can I get out of paying my SBA loan?

Generally, SBA loans are legally binding and must be repaid. However, in specific hardship situations, options like deferment or restructuring may be available. Consulting with an SBA loan specialist in Kansas can clarify your repayment obligations and potential solutions.

What is the SBA $10,000 grant?

The SBA does not offer direct $10,000 grants to businesses. Grants are typically awarded for specific purposes, often to non-profits or for research. SBA loans, however, provide capital that businesses can use for various operational needs and expansion.
